AiDASH is an enterprise AI company and the leading provider of vegetation risk intelligence for electric utilities. Powered by proprietary VegetationAI technology, AiDASH delivers a unified remote grid inspection and itoring platform that uses a elliteFirst approach to identify and address vegetation and other threats to the grid. With a prevention-first strategy to mitigate wildfire risk and minimize storm impacts, AiDASH helps more than 140 utilities reduce costs, improve reliability, and lower liability across their networks. The Role
We are looking for a Senior Machine Learning Engineer to design, build, and deploy scalable ML and deep learning systems for Earth observation, asset intelligence, and operational ision-making. You will collaborate closely with data scientists, data engineers, and product teams to convert research models into reliable production-grade systems powering AiDash s core products.
How youll make an impact:
-
Design and implement ML pipelines for large-scale geospatial, temporal, and structured datasets
-
Productionize models for classification, segmentation, object detection, and predictive analytics across vegetation, infrastructure, and environmental domains
-
Build scalable training, validation, and deployment workflows on cloud infrastructure (AWS, Kubernetes, Snowflake, etc.)
-
Collaborate with domain experts and data engineers to enhance model performance and data quality
-
Lead experiments in model optimization, generalization across geographies, and multimodal fusion ( ellite + IoT + text data)
-
Mentor ior engineers and contribute to best practices for reproducible ML development
